Alpha particles,each having a charge of +2e and a mass of 6.64 ×10-27 kg,are accelerated in a uniform 0.80-T magnetic field to a final orbit radius of 0.30 m.The field is perpendicular to the velocity of the particles.How long does it take an alpha particle to make one complete circle in the final orbit? (e = 1.60 × 10-19C)
Declarative Memory
Declarative memory is a type of long-term memory that involves the conscious recollection of factual information, experiences, and concepts, also known as explicit memory.
Episodic Memory
A type of long-term memory that involves the recollection of specific events, situations, and experiences.
Anterograde Amnesia
A condition where an individual is unable to form new memories following the onset of an amnesia-causing event, although memories from before the event remain intact.
Hippocampus
A part of the brain involved in forming, organizing, and storing memories.
